Overview
An act to reenact the north carolina child tax credit, to expand the north carolina prekindergarten (nc pre-k) program and increase care subsidy by appropriating funds for those purposes, to provide lunch IN public schools at no cost to students through an allocation based on school food authority evaluations, to appropriate funds for public child care provided by community colleges, and to require a report on the feasibility and advisability of a high school child care apprenticeship program.
